Right now ophthalmologists in India use perioperative povidone-iodine along and draped as well as meticulous sterile preparation, which is supposed to be effective in limiting the incidence of endophthalmitis after cataract surgery. Topical antibiotic prophylaxis is also common in practice. Moxifloxacin is a fourth-generation fluoroquinolone that was approved for topical ophthalmic use in 2003. Intracameral moxifloxacin is also found to be an effective alternative for endophthalmitis prophylaxis. A very large study conducted at Aravind Eye Hospital, Maduri, studied the effect of intracameral moxifloxacin on the rate of endophthalmitis incidence. The study involved the data of some 600000 consecutive cataract patients. They reported that the use of intra cameral moxifloxacin reduced the incidence of endophthalmitis in pheco surgery by 3 and a half times . It even reduced the endophthalmitis incidence in patients who had posterior capsular rent. Intracameral injection of Vigamox brand topical moxifloxacin, which is unpreserved, is a more popular option. Several studies have reported on the method and the safety of using topical branded Vigamox for Intracameral prophylaxis. Generic topical moxifloxacin contains preservatives and other adjuvants that are not safe for intraocular use
